Hairy Vetch

    Description

    Hairy vetch is the most cold tolerant winter annual legume. Tolerating temperatures as low as -30 degrees, this is best planted before the first frost in the fall and then it will resume growth in the spring. Hairy vetch is slower to green up and has slower spring growth compared to cereal rye and wheat but once it does get going, it grows very fast, doubling it’s growth each week through the month of May. With patience and a delayed corn planting, a full stand of vetch can consistently produce over 200 lbs of nitrogen in its biomass. As part of a winter cover crop or forage mix, vetch is commonly grown with rye or triticale.

        When is the right time to plant?

        Hairy Vetch has a minimum germination temp of 48 °F. Reference your average soil temperature to determine ideal planting time.

        Basic Info

        N Fix Potential 100 - 200
        Seeds/lb 12000
        C/N at Maturity Low
        Growth Habit Vining
        Root Type/Depth Medium Taproot
        Cold Kill -20 °F
        Dry Matter Potential 1 - 3 tons/acre

        Use & Characteristics

        Maturity Biennial days
        Lasting Residue Fair
        Palatability Very Good
        Hay Harvest Good
        Regrowth Good
        Deep Compaction Fair
        Surface Compaction Very Good
        Weed Suppression Very Good
        Crimp Kill Easy

        Planting

        Plant Depth 1/2 - 1 1/2"
        Min Germ Temp 48 °F
        Drilled Seed Rate 15 - 20 lbs/acre
        Broadcast Seed Rate 25 - 30 lbs/acre

        Tolerance

        Heat Fair
        Drought Good
        Shade Good
        Wet Soil Fair
        Low Fertility Good
        Low pH Soil Good
        High pH Salinity Good
        High pH Calcareous Good
